Planning Content Around Product Knowledge and Customer Questions
Start your content calendar by mapping out your product catalog and identifying key themes based on product features, supplier specs, and customer benefits. For stores with large catalogs or many SKUs, grouping products into collections and focusing content on these groupings can streamline your content efforts. For example, a blog post might explain the differences between product types within a collection or provide a detailed buying guide that answers common buyer intent queries.
Customer questions and buyer pain points are goldmines for blog topics. Analyzing FAQs, customer reviews, and support tickets helps uncover what shoppers want to know. This insight guides keyword selection for SEO blog posts that educate readers while naturally linking to product pages. Connecting Blogs, Product Pages, and Collection SEO
Effective internal linking between blog posts, product pages, and collections strengthens your Shopify store's SEO and user experience. Blog articles that educate customers about product features or buying considerations should link directly to relevant product pages. Similarly, collection pages can feature links to blog posts that provide deeper context or buying advice, creating a content ecosystem that guides shoppers through their journey.
Organizing your content calendar to produce long-tail SEO blog posts and FAQs that complement collection pages helps capture niche search queries. This layered approach to content supports product-led SEO by addressing specific buyer intent and funnel stages, from awareness to decision, all while driving traffic to your product catalog.

Comparison Table: Content Types and Their Role in a Shopify Content Calendar
| Content Type | Purpose | SEO Focus | Workflow Tips |
|---|---|---|---|
| Product Education Articles | Explain features and benefits | Target buyer intent keywords | Use product specs and customer questions as inputs |
| Buying Guides | Help customers choose products | Long-tail keywords, comparison phrases | Link to multiple product pages and collections |
| Seasonal Gift Guides | Promote timely products | Seasonal and event-related keywords | Plan content ahead of peak seasons |
| FAQ Content | Answer common customer questions | Question-based search queries | Update regularly based on customer feedback |
| Collection SEO Posts | Highlight product groupings | Category and niche keywords | Connect with related blog posts and products |
